Scrum: Como Fazer a Gestão de Projetos de Tecnologia
O Scrum é uma metodologia ágil de gestão de projetos de tecnologia. Conheça seus princípios, benefícios e dicas para implementá-lo com sucesso. Descubra como fazer a gestão de projetos de tecnologia com Scrum e obtenha maior visibilidade, produtividade, flexibilidade e adaptabilidade. Confira o passo a passo para implementar o Scrum na gestão de projetos de tecnologia e aprenda as melhores práticas para obter resultados significativos. A Awari oferece cursos e mentorias individuais para aprimorar suas habilidades em gestão de produtos.
Navegue pelo conteúdo
O Que é Scrum e Como Ele Funciona na Gestão de Projetos de Tecnologia
Introdução
Scrum é uma metodologia ágil de gestão de projetos que tem sido amplamente utilizada na área de tecnologia. Ela foi desenvolvida para lidar com a complexidade e incertezas que muitas vezes estão presentes nesse tipo de projeto. Ao contrário das abordagens tradicionais, o Scrum é baseado em uma abordagem iterativa e incremental, que permite maior flexibilidade e adaptabilidade durante todo o processo.
Essência do Scrum
A essência do Scrum está na formação de equipes autônomas e multidisciplinares, que trabalham em ciclos chamados de sprints. Cada sprint tem uma duração fixa, geralmente de duas a quatro semanas, e tem como objetivo entregar um incremento de valor ao final de cada ciclo. Durante o sprint, a equipe se organiza em torno de um conjunto de tarefas definidas no início do ciclo e se compromete a entregá-las dentro do prazo estabelecido.
Transparência
Um dos principais pilares do Scrum é a transparência. Todas as informações relevantes sobre o projeto, como o backlog de tarefas, o progresso do sprint e os impedimentos enfrentados pela equipe, devem ser visíveis e compartilhadas por todos os membros do time. Isso promove a colaboração e a tomada de decisões mais assertivas.
Reuniões Diárias
Outro aspecto importante do Scrum é a realização de reuniões diárias, conhecidas como Daily Scrum ou stand-up meetings. Nesses encontros, a equipe se reúne por alguns minutos para compartilhar atualizações rápidas sobre o trabalho realizado, os planos para o dia e eventuais obstáculos que estão enfrentando. Essa prática ajuda a manter todos os membros do time alinhados e a identificar possíveis problemas de forma antecipada.
Principais Benefícios do Scrum na Gestão de Projetos de Tecnologia
Ao adotar o Scrum na gestão de projetos de tecnologia, as organizações podem colher diversos benefícios. Vejamos alguns dos principais:
Maior visibilidade e controle
O Scrum proporciona uma visão clara do progresso do projeto, permitindo que a equipe e os stakeholders acompanhem de perto o andamento das atividades. Isso facilita a identificação de possíveis problemas e a tomada de ações corretivas de forma ágil.
Aumento da produtividade
Com o Scrum, as equipes trabalham de forma mais focada e organizada. O planejamento detalhado dos sprints e a realização de reuniões diárias ajudam a manter todos os membros do time alinhados e engajados. Isso resulta em um aumento da produtividade e da eficiência no desenvolvimento do projeto.
Maior flexibilidade e adaptabilidade
O Scrum permite que as equipes se adaptem rapidamente a mudanças de requisitos ou imprevistos durante o desenvolvimento do projeto. Isso é especialmente importante na área de tecnologia, onde as demandas e as necessidades dos clientes podem mudar com frequência.
Melhoria contínua
O Scrum incentiva a retrospectiva ao final de cada sprint, onde a equipe analisa o que foi bem-sucedido e o que pode ser melhorado. Essa prática promove uma cultura de aprendizado e melhoria contínua, resultando em um processo de desenvolvimento cada vez mais eficiente e eficaz.
Dicas e Melhores Práticas para Fazer a Gestão de Projetos de Tecnologia com Scrum
Para obter os melhores resultados na gestão de projetos de tecnologia utilizando o Scrum, é importante seguir algumas dicas e melhores práticas. Vejamos algumas delas:
Defina claramente os objetivos do projeto
Antes de iniciar o desenvolvimento, é fundamental ter uma visão clara dos objetivos a serem alcançados. Isso ajudará a direcionar o trabalho da equipe e a manter todos alinhados.
Mantenha o backlog atualizado
O backlog é a lista de tarefas a serem realizadas durante o projeto. É importante mantê-lo atualizado, priorizando as atividades de maior valor e revisando-o regularmente para garantir que esteja alinhado com as necessidades do cliente.
Realize reuniões de planejamento eficazes
As reuniões de planejamento dos sprints são fundamentais para definir as atividades a serem realizadas e estimar o esforço necessário para cada uma delas. Certifique-se de que essas reuniões sejam bem estruturadas e envolvam toda a equipe.
Promova a colaboração e a comunicação
O Scrum valoriza a colaboração e a comunicação entre os membros da equipe. Estimule o compartilhamento de conhecimentos e a troca de informações, criando um ambiente propício para o trabalho em equipe.
Monitore o progresso do projeto
Utilize ferramentas de acompanhamento e controle para manter-se atualizado sobre o progresso do projeto. Isso permitirá identificar possíveis desvios e tomar ações corretivas de forma ágil.
Conclusão
O Scrum é uma metodologia ágil de gestão de projetos de tecnologia que tem se mostrado eficaz na entrega de resultados. Ao adotar o Scrum, as organizações podem obter maior controle, produtividade, flexibilidade e adaptabilidade em seus projetos. No entanto, é importante seguir as dicas e melhores práticas para garantir o sucesso da implementação. Com uma equipe capacitada e comprometida, aliada a um ambiente propício para a colaboração, a gestão de projetos de tecnologia com Scrum pode trazer resultados significativos para as organizações.
Passo a Passo para Implementar o Scrum na Gestão de Projetos de Tecnologia
Implementar o Scrum na gestão de projetos de tecnologia pode trazer inúmeros benefícios para as empresas. No entanto, é importante seguir um passo a passo bem estruturado para garantir o sucesso da implementação. A seguir, apresentaremos um guia prático para ajudar você a implementar o Scrum na gestão de projetos de tecnologia:
1. Entenda os princípios do Scrum
Antes de começar a implementação, é fundamental compreender os princípios e valores do Scrum. Familiarize-se com os papéis, artefatos e cerimônias do Scrum, para que você possa ter uma visão clara de como a metodologia funciona.
2. Monte uma equipe Scrum
O próximo passo é formar uma equipe Scrum. Essa equipe deve ser multidisciplinar, composta por profissionais com habilidades complementares necessárias para o desenvolvimento do projeto. É importante garantir que todos os membros da equipe estejam comprometidos e tenham um entendimento claro dos objetivos do projeto.
3. Defina o Product Owner
O Product Owner é responsável por definir as necessidades do cliente e priorizar o backlog de tarefas. É importante escolher alguém com conhecimento do negócio e capacidade de tomar decisões rápidas e assertivas.
4. Crie o backlog do produto
O backlog do produto é uma lista de todas as funcionalidades e requisitos do projeto. O Product Owner deve trabalhar em conjunto com a equipe para definir as prioridades e detalhar as tarefas necessárias. É importante garantir que o backlog esteja sempre atualizado e alinhado com as necessidades do cliente.
5. Planeje os sprints
Os sprints são ciclos de trabalho dentro do Scrum, com duração fixa de duas a quatro semanas. Durante o planejamento de cada sprint, a equipe deve selecionar as tarefas do backlog que serão realizadas durante o ciclo. É importante definir as metas do sprint e estimar o esforço necessário para cada tarefa.
6. Realize as cerimônias do Scrum
Durante a implementação do Scrum, é importante realizar as cerimônias do Scrum de forma regular. Isso inclui a Daily Scrum, uma reunião diária para compartilhar o progresso e identificar impedimentos, a Sprint Review, uma reunião para revisar o trabalho concluído no sprint, e a Sprint Retrospective, uma reunião para refletir sobre o que funcionou bem e identificar oportunidades de melhoria.
7. Mantenha a transparência
A transparência é um dos princípios fundamentais do Scrum. É importante manter todos os envolvidos no projeto informados sobre o andamento do trabalho, impedimentos e resultados alcançados. Utilize ferramentas visuais, como quadros Kanban, para facilitar a visualização do progresso do projeto.
Dicas e Melhores Práticas para Fazer a Gestão de Projetos de Tecnologia com Scrum
Além de seguir o passo a passo para implementar o Scrum na gestão de projetos de tecnologia, existem algumas dicas e melhores práticas que podem ajudar a obter melhores resultados. Vejamos algumas delas:
- Comunique-se de forma eficiente: A comunicação é essencial para o sucesso do projeto. Mantenha todos os membros da equipe informados sobre as atividades em andamento, os prazos e eventuais mudanças. Utilize ferramentas adequadas para facilitar a comunicação e a colaboração, como softwares de gestão de projetos.
- Estabeleça metas claras: Defina metas claras e mensuráveis para o projeto. Isso ajudará a manter todos os membros da equipe alinhados e focados nos objetivos. Divida as metas em partes menores e acompanhe o progresso regularmente.
- Promova a colaboração: Incentive a colaboração e o trabalho em equipe. Estabeleça um ambiente de confiança e encoraje a participação de todos os membros da equipe. Promova a troca de conhecimento e estimule a resolução de problemas em conjunto.
- Realize retrospectivas: As retrospectivas são momentos importantes para refletir sobre o trabalho realizado e identificar oportunidades de melhoria. Reserve um tempo para realizar retrospectivas regulares e incentive a equipe a compartilhar feedbacks e sugestões de forma aberta e construtiva.
- Aprenda com os erros: O Scrum valoriza a aprendizagem contínua. Ao identificar erros ou falhas, encare-os como oportunidades de aprendizado e melhoria. Busque entender as causas raízes dos problemas e implemente ações corretivas para evitar que eles se repitam no futuro.
- Promova a autogestão: O Scrum valoriza a autogestão das equipes. Dê autonomia para que os membros da equipe tomem decisões e se responsabilizem pelo trabalho. Isso estimula o engajamento e a criatividade, resultando em melhores resultados.
Implemente o Scrum na Gestão de Projetos de Tecnologia
Implementar o Scrum na gestão de projetos de tecnologia pode ser um desafio, mas os benefícios são significativos. Ao seguir um passo a passo estruturado e aplicar as melhores práticas, as organizações podem alcançar maior eficiência, produtividade e qualidade nos seus projetos de tecnologia. Lembre-se de adaptar o Scrum às necessidades específicas do seu projeto e equipe, e esteja aberto a ajustes e melhorias ao longo do caminho.
A Awari é a melhor plataforma para aprender sobre gestão de produtos no Brasil.
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.
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.
